Description
Cheese bread is a delicious and savory bread that is perfect for any occasion. It is made with a combination of flour, yeast, milk, butter, salt, and cheese. The cheese adds a rich and creamy flavor to the bread, making it perfect for serving with soups, salads, or as a snack.
Prep Time
Preparation time for cheese bread is about 10 minutes. This includes measuring the ingredients, shredding the cheese, and mixing the dough.
Cook Time
Cooking time for cheese bread is approximately 3 hours, which includes the time needed for the dough to rise and bake in the bread maker.
Ingredients
3 cups of all-purpose flour
1 package of active dry yeast
1 cup of warm milk
1/4 cup of melted butter
1 teaspoon of salt
2 cups of shredded cheddar cheese
Equipment
Bread maker
Measuring cups and spoons
Cheese grater
Method
Place the flour, yeast, warm milk, melted butter, and salt into the bread maker.
Select the dough cycle on the bread maker and start the machine.
Once the dough is ready, remove it from the bread maker and place it on a floured surface.
Knead the dough for a few minutes and then add the shredded cheese.
Knead the dough again until the cheese is evenly distributed.
Shape the dough into a loaf and place it in a greased bread pan.
Cover the bread pan with plastic wrap and let it rise in a warm place for about an hour.
Preheat the oven to 375°F.
Bake the bread in the oven for about 30-40 minutes or until it is golden brown on top.
Remove the bread from the oven and let it cool for a few minutes before slicing and serving.
Notes
This recipe can easily be modified to include different types of cheese or herbs.
It is important to let the bread rise in a warm place to ensure that it is light and fluffy.
If you do not have a bread maker, you can make the dough by hand and then bake it in the oven.

Recipes FAQ
Can I use a different type of cheese?
Yes, you can use any type of cheese that you prefer. Some good options include mozzarella, pepper jack, or gouda.
Can I make this recipe by hand?
Yes, you can make the dough by hand and then bake it in the oven. Simply follow the instructions for mixing the dough and then place it in a greased bread pan. Let it rise in a warm place for about an hour before baking in the oven at 375°F for 30-40 minutes.
Can I freeze the bread?
Yes, you can freeze the bread. Simply w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and then place it in a freezer-safe container. When you are ready to eat the bread, remove it from the freezer and let it thaw at room temperature.
Recipe Tips
Make sure that your cheese is shredded finely so that it is evenly distributed throughout the bread.
If you want a more intense cheese flavor, you can add some grated parmesan cheese to the dough.
If you do not have warm milk, you can heat it up in the microwave for a few seconds or until it is warm to the touch.
If you do not have a bread pan, you can shape the dough into a round loaf and bake it on a baking sheet.
